The top 5 strategic actions to take right now

  1. Define what your business will look like when its done & when that will be.  Make a 1, 2 & 5 year projection of your business and if possible set a time frame for a future sale of your business.  Make a spreadsheet with column headings like turnover, profit, markets, products, employee numbers, debt level and others and make rows with 2009, 2010 & 2013 then put the big picture targets in the cells.

  2. Document who or what has to help you or change in order to affect each of the changes to these variables.  Items that should be addressed include identifying what will change in relation to training new employees, recruiting new employees, coaching for you and key decision makers, research and development of new products and markets, finance solutions, new software solutions etc.
  3. Systemise every step of every process in your business.  Until you've documented the way you do what you do, you are making it up every day.  Define the right way and write it down so that new employees have resources to assist with induction, training and upskilling so that everyone within your business as well as customers and suppliers receive a consistent and reliable product and service.  This approach must not just be focused on the delivery of your product or service but the complete business including documenting your finance systems, human resources systems, management systems, sales systems, marketing systems, administration systems, quality systems and more.  Understand the intricate web that exists between the processes that occur in one area with those of another.  The effect of this will ultimately tell on the final pay day for your business...sale day!
  4. Discover the 'face' of your business to the outside world.  Experience first hand the paths to your door from a customers perspective.  Make phone in and email inquiries from all of your marketing sources to ensure that they are operating how you intend.  You would be amazed at how many internet inquiry forms that you complete on web sites that are never responded to...is that you?  Further to this measure the cost of acquiring leads from each source and either stop completely or radically reduce the expenditure on those avenues that produce the least cost effective results.  Just because your competitor does it doesn't make it right!
  5. Ask questions.  Ask your employees, customers, suppliers...everyone.  Implement a job satisfaction survey that seeks feedback anonomoyusly from your employees about their roles and the systems they work within.  Ask your customers to tell you what you did right and most importantly what you have done wrong.  Tell them that you are on a mission to become the best <insert product/service> in the market place and that their feedback is vital to you being able to give them the service they deserve.
